摘要
According to four potential energy surfaces of MP4 and SCF with/without counterpoise (CP) procedure, the influence of electronic correlation effect and CP to remove the superposition errors on the equilibrium geometry of He-H2O complex is discussed and accurate equilibrium geometry of He-H2O is obtained. It is shown that the applications of both electronic correlation and CP are necessary in the calculations of weak van der Waals complex, by means of effective basis set.
